Joshua O’Hair is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Biomedical Engineering and Biotechnology. According to data from OpenAlex, Joshua O’Hair has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 323 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Molecular Biology, 11 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 6 papers in Biotechnology. Recurrent topics in Joshua O’Hair’s work include Biofuel production and bioconversion (11 papers), Metabolic Engineering and Synthetic Biology (7 papers) and Enzyme Production and Characterization (6 papers). Joshua O’Hair is often cited by papers focused on Biofuel production and bioconversion (11 papers), Metabolic Engineering and Synthetic Biology (7 papers) and Enzyme Production and Characterization (6 papers). Joshua O’Hair collaborates with scholars based in United States and India. Joshua O’Hair's co-authors include Suping Zhou, Santosh Thapa, Sarabjit Bhatti, Jitendra Mishra, Priya Mishra, Naveen Kumar Arora, Hui Li, Qing Jin, Haibo Huang and Kamal Al Nasr and has published in prestigious journals such as Waste Management, ACS Sustainable Chemistry & Engineering and Cellulose.
